David Cronenberg cannot say enough positive things about his Cosmopolis leading man, Robert Pattinson and is upset by the critical reviews the 25-year-old actor has received for his performances thus far.
“All I know is…I thought that Robert was very underrated,” David recently told Movieweb. “I don’t think that any director who’s looking to see what Rob can do, will not be able to see how terrific he is by looking at Cosmopolis. Even if the movie isn’t a success at the box office, creatively, as far as I’m concerned, it is a success, and for Rob, it totally is. He’s brilliant in the movie, he’s fabulous. If nothing else, it will be a great demo film for Rob, for any other director who’s looking for a great actor.”
David also raved about Robert to PopSugar recently, calling him “fantastic” and explaining why he appreciates Rob’s work in the Twilight franchise.
“The only thing about Twilight movies that was important for Cosmopolis was that it gave Robert the fame that we needed to support our budget,” David explained to PopSugar.
